Andreas couple win DEFA prize
The Department of Environment, Food and Agriculture has named an Andreas couple the Farmers of the Future.
Tim and Maria Johnston of Ballavarry Farm were presented with the award at the Royal Manx Agricultural Show on Friday.
The pair have more than 200 Holstein Friesian dairy cows and supply milk to the Isle of Man Creamery from their almost 400 acre farm.
David Collister, of Southampton Farm in Port Soderick won the Judges’ Special Award for a Young Farmer.
